This podcast discusses Google File System (GFS) as a case study for building big storage systems, highlighting its key role as a simple and general storage interface in distributed systems. The discussion covers the challenges in distributed storage, such as achieving high performance, fault tolerance, replication, and consistency, and how these factors create tensions in system design. The lecture explains GFS's architecture, including the master and chunk servers, and dives into the read and write processes, addressing potential failures and consistency issues. The podcast also touches on the design considerations for strong consistency, and the trade-offs made in GFS for performance reasons.
Sign in to continue reading, translating and more.
Continue